VBscript 的正则表达式 字符串匹配

网络编程 2025-03-23 20:58www.168986.cn编程入门

我们来分析字符串的模式。这里的关键是要匹配所有出现的“DGK”,并将其替换为“MSN”。在正则表达式中,我们可以使用简单的模式匹配来完成这个任务。在这种情况下,不需要复杂的正则表达式模式,因为我们要替换的字符串是固定的。

匹配式的写法如下:

```python

import re

原始字符串

str_to_replace = "str, DGK, rDJK, DJKl,DGK , end"

使用正则表达式替换 "DGK" 为 "MSN"

pattern = "DGK"

replacement = "MSN"

result = re.sub(pattern, replacement, str_to_replace)

print(result) 输出结果应为:"str, MSN, rDJK, DJKl,MSN , end"

```

在这个例子中,我们使用了Python的`re.sub()`函数来替换字符串中的特定部分。这个函数接受三个参数:要匹配的字符串模式(在这种情况下是固定的字符串“DGK”),替换后的字符串(在这里是“MSN”),以及原始字符串。该函数会返回一个新的字符串,其中所有匹配的子字符串都被替换为指定的字符串。这样,我们就能够轻松地将“DGK”替换为“MSN”。

上一篇:在MySQL中自定义参数的使用详解 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by